Stuffed Acorn Squash

Roasted acorn squash halves stuffed with curried ground turkey, applesauce, and raisin bread cubes. A low-calorie fall dinner for two with warm, cozy spices.

Acorn squash is one of those vegetables that’s practically begging to be stuffed. Cut it in half, scoop out the seeds, and you’ve got a built-in bowl just waiting for something savory.

This filling mixes ground turkey (or pork) with celery, onion, curry powder, and cinnamon, then folds in applesauce and cubed raisin bread for a sweet-spiced stuffing that’s hearty without being heavy.

It’s a complete dinner for two that comes in at low calories and fills the kitchen with the warm, autumnal aromas of curry and cinnamon baking together.

Kitchen Tips

  • Bake the squash cut-side down first to steam the flesh tender. Flipping it over to fill comes after the first 50 minutes.
  • The microwave method works in a fraction of the time if you’re short on patience. Both methods give you tender, scoopable squash.
  • Unsweetened applesauce keeps the filling moist and adds natural sweetness without extra sugar.

Directions

Spray a 10 x 6 x 2” baking dish with Pam. Halve squash; discard seeds.

Place squash, cut side down, in baking dish.

Bake, uncovered, in 350℉ (180℃) oven 50 minutes.

Meanwhile, for stuffing, in a skillet cook turkey, celery, and onion until meat is no longer pink and vegetables are tender. Drain off fat. Stir in salt, curry powder, and cinnamon; cook 1 minute more. Stir in applesauce and bread cubes.

Turn squash cut side up in dish. Place stuffing in squash halves.

Bake uncovered, 20 minutes more.

MICROWAVE DIRECTIONS:

Place squash, cut side down in a 10 x 6 x 2” microwave-safe baking dish.

Micro-cook on 100% power (high) for 6½ to 6½ minutes or until tender. Set aside.

In a 1 qt casserole cook turkey, celery, and onion, covered, on high for 2 to 3 minutes or until turkey is no longer pink, stirring twice. Drain.

Stir in curry powder, salt, and cinnamon. Cook 30 seconds more. Stir in applesauce and bread cubes. Spoon into squash halves.

Cook, uncovered, on high for 3 to 4 minutes or until heated through.
